Deceased Name: Bernard J. Dietzel

Bernard J. Dietzel, 80, of East Dubuque, died at 10:20 p.m. Friday, March 26, 2010, at Mercy Medical Center-Dubuque. Services were held Tuesday, March 30, at St. Mary's Catholic Church, East Dubuque, with the Rev. Michael Barry officiating. Burial was in the East Dubuque Cemetery, where military rites were accorded by members of East Dubuque American Legion Post 787.

He was born on Dec. 13, 1929, in Dubuque, son of Cornelius and Louisa (Vondran) Dietzel. He married Rita M. Middendorf on Oct. 14, 1952, at Nativity BVM Church, Menominee; she preceded him in death on Nov. 20, 2009.

Bernard and Rita farmed near East Dubuque. Bernard was an Army veteran of the Korean Conflict, serving from 1952 to 1954, having been stationed in Austria and Germany. He was a member of St. Mary's Parish and its Holy Name Society and a 53-year member of American Legion Post 787 of East Dubuque, having served as past commander. He also was a charter member and former chief of the Menominee-Dunleith Fire Department, a member of the Jo Daviess County Board from 1988 to 1992, and a former trustee and election judge for Dunleith Township.

Surviving are three daughters, Diane (Kevin) Torrey, of Dubuque, Shirley (Dave) Horstman, of East Dubuque, and Jeanne (John) Kringle, of Zwingle, Iowa; a son, Bob (Carol) Dietzel, of East Dubuque; Seven grandchildren, Jonathon (Abby), Michael and Kristin Torrey, Cassandra and Kayla Horstman, and Nicholas and Andrew Kringle; a great-grandson, Kasey Torrey; a sister-in-law, Rosalinda Wubben, of Scales Mound; two brothers-in-law, Walter (Marceline) Middendorf and Tony (Jane) Middendorf, both of Menominee; and many nieces and nephews.

He also was preceded in death by his parents and a brother, Wilbert Dietzel.
